首页 实锤现场文章正文

关于51网,我把版本差别讲清楚后,很多问题都通了

实锤现场 2026年03月01日 00:22 126 V5IfhMOK8g

关于51网,我把版本差别讲清楚后,很多问题都通了

关于51网,我把版本差别讲清楚后,很多问题都通了

很多时候,问题不是出在用户,而是出在版本。把每个版本的边界和差异讲清楚后,团队沟通效率一下子上来了,用户反馈的“这产品怎么又不一样了”也少了。下面把我多年处理版本差异、排查故障的经验梳理成一篇实用指南,直接可以贴到你的Google网站上,供团队和用户参考。

一眼看清:51网有哪几类“版本” 不同场景下,“版本”指的东西不一样。对症下药前,先把常见类型分清楚:

  • 发布渠道:PC网页版、移动H5、Android、iOS、小程序、企业定制版。
  • 功能分支:基础版、专业版、企业版、海外版(国际化)等。
  • 接口层级:前端视图版、后端API版本、第三方服务版本(支付、短信、地图)。
  • 部署环境:生产、预发布、灰度、开发、测试。
  • 历史遗留:旧版兼容包、迁移分支、临时补丁分支。

很多问题来自这几类交叉影响:比如“手机能登录但浏览器不能”,往往是渠道差异;“新功能用户看不到”,常常是灰度/权限或API版本不一致。

常见问题与对应排查路径(实用清单) 遇到问题时按下面顺序快速定位,避免盲目改动:

  1. 确认用户使用的是哪个“版本”
  • 查看客户端标识、User-Agent、APP版本号或页面底部/请求头里的版本信息。
  • 问清访问入口:官网域名、子域、企业定制域名或API域名。
  1. 查接口与前端是否匹配
  • 抓包看接口返回字段是否与前端预期一致。字段缺失、结构变化是常见原因。
  • 检查API版本号、请求参数和响应格式。
  1. 检查权限与灰度策略
  • 是否有按用户、按渠道或按地域的灰度控制?功能开关是否同步?
  • 确认是否属于AB测试组或企业定制用户未开通功能。
  1. 环境与部署差异
  • 生产与预发布是否同步数据库、缓存、配置。
  • 有无CDN缓存、负载均衡规则或跨域限制(CORS)导致差异。
  1. 第三方服务差异
  • 支付、短信、地图等服务的密钥、回调地址或SDK版本不同,常引起“场景特定”问题。

典型问题与解决示例(我处理过的案例)

  • 场景:移动端用户提示“缺少字段”,PC端正常。 诊断:前端切换到了新的轻量版UI,调用的是老API版本,API已去掉某些冗余字段。 解决:短期在前端做兼容层映射,长期统一API版本并通知客户端升级。

  • 场景:部分企业用户导出数据失败。 诊断:企业版使用的是独立导出服务且部署在不同集群,导出任务队列在维护窗口被暂停。 解决:调整维护策略,加入业务告警并在界面提示维护时间;同时在导出接口返回明确错误码,方便定位。

  • 场景:新功能上线后,部分用户样式错乱。 诊断:老版静态资源被CDN缓存,用户仍加载旧CSS。 解决:更新静态资源版本号(cache-busting),并在发布说明中列出可能的兼容提示。

升级与兼容策略:减少未来问题的几条实用做法

  • 版本管理透明:在用户能看到的位置(帮助页、关于页)明示版本号与发布时间。
  • API版本化:靠版本号维护向后兼容,弃用周期与迁移文档提前公布。
  • 功能开关与灰度:所有发布在可控的开关下,通过配置实现逐步放量。
  • 回滚与热修复路径:发布前准备好回滚脚本与热修复包,避免紧急修复成为新问题源头。
  • 自动化验证:每个版本必须有最小自动化回归集,覆盖登录、关键业务流程和接口兼容性。

如何快速让团队和用户“通了”

  • 做一份简明的版本差异对照表,覆盖渠道、功能、API、已知限制和升级建议。
  • 每次发布在更新日志里写清变更点与可能影响的用户群体。
  • 对客服与一线工程师做一次简短的“版本差异brief”,把常见问题和排查步骤分享给他们。
  • 对外把常见兼容问题写成FAQ,减少重复咨询。

结语(实战提醒) 把版本差别讲清楚,不是形式工作,而是把隐性复杂度变成显性规则:团队按规则行动,问题自然少,用户理解也多。需要我把你当前的版本体系梳理成一页对照表或写一份面向用户的版本说明,我可以代为整理并给出迁移建议。欢迎联系,直接部署到网站上即可使用。

标签: 关于 我把 版本

黑料不打烊社区 - 吃瓜爆料与今日黑料在线 备案号:桂ICP备20278901号 桂公网安备 450103202789012号